An EC210 Volvo Excavator: Thorough Dive into Vecu Systems

The EC210 Volvo Excavator is a robust machine known for its capability. One of the key features that sets it apart is the integrated Vecu system. This advanced technology plays a essential role in optimizing the excavator's overall operation. Vecu systems use sensors to collect data on various aspects of the machine, such as engine parameters, hydraulic output, and working conditions. This feedback is then processed by a central control unit to modify the excavator's systems in real time.

  • Advantages of Vecu Systems:
  • Optimized Fuel Economy
  • Reduced Maintenance Costs
  • Increased Machine Uptime
  • Enhanced Operator Comfort

Vecu systems offer a range of advantages for operators and fleet managers. By streamlining various machine functions, Vecu systems lead to improved fuel efficiency, reduced maintenance costs, increased reliability, and enhanced operator comfort.

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their reliability and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By modifying vir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

Volvo Truck ECU Simulation Software: Creating Immersive Test Scenarios

Developing and refining the Electronic Control Units (ECUs) which Volvo trucks requires meticulous testing in volvo ec210 vecu a range of simulated environments. ECU simulation software facilitates engineers to develop highly realistic virtual platforms that replicate the challenges of real-world driving scenarios. These simulations provide a safe and controlled setting for testing ECU performance under diverse conditions, such as fluctuating temperatures, terrain, and pressures.

  • Benefits of using ECU simulation software include reduced development time, cost savings through elimination of physical prototypes, and the ability to detect potential issues early in the design process.
  • Volvo Truck's commitment to innovation fuels the development of sophisticated ECU simulation software that constantly being refined to precisely model the details of their vehicles.

By leveraging this cutting-edge technology, Volvo Trucks delivers reliable and optimal ECUs that meet the demanding requirements of modern trucking operations.
